Facts about Whatever

✔️

Who wrote Whatever lyrics?


Whatever is written by Lisa Drew, Shaye Smith.
✔️

When was Whatever released?


It is first released on March 23, 1999 as part of Jessica Andrews's album "Heart Shaped World" which includes 12 tracks in total. This song is the 3rd track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Whatever?


Whatever falls under the genre Country.
✔️

How long is the song Whatever?


Whatever song length is 3 minutes and 20 seconds.
